TURNED TO HATRED.

ANGLO-FRENCH ATTITDDE. GERMANY’S OUTSPOKEN CLAIM. LONDON, March 20. “The earthquake which shook England and France last week has turned their attitude toward Germany info hatred,” declares the official German radio. Jt goes on: “The era of Western democracies has ended. Germany is the greatest central European Power, responsible for the maintenance of peace, and is entitled to act as she considers expedient.-” Official circles in Berlin arc startled at the British and French refusal to recognise the annexation of Czechoslovakia, but no official comment has yet been made. The National Zeitung says that if the termination of the Munich Agreement represents the wishes of Britain, the people of Britain must be regarded as the enemy of existence.
